It's an obscured part of the Joker's wardrobe, but the grey blazer he wears under the topcoat is still another piece that is needed to complete an accurate costume.
I would like to know if anyone has any specific suggestions as to which brand and style blazer should be bought in order to be as movie-accurate as possible. I already have some orange satin fabric lined up to replace the lining.
Any photos or suggestions please post here!
